Root crops – beets, carrots, potatoes, sweet … WitrynaA Small Bite of Oxalate Chemistry. Sorrel is very high in oxalate. When oxalic acid, which is water-soluble, combines with mineral ions it yields various oxalate “salts.”. These mineral salts form minute crystals. Some types of oxalates remain soluble, such as sodium oxalate, and some form insoluble solids, such as calcium oxalate.
Witryna6 cze 2024 · Wild fermentation of high oxalate vegetables like kimchi, sauerkraut, and pickles has been found in studies to lower the levels of oxalates significantly during … WitrynaCooking foods may also lower oxalate content. Oxalates dissolve in water, and some research indicates that boiling vegetables for 12 minutes can lower their oxalate content by 30-87%, with leafy greens like spinach and Swiss chard showing the greatest losses at about 85%. Steaming had less of an effect, showing about 45% loss of oxalates. [8]
